Description

1, The Green: Nestled at the end of a peaceful cul-de-sac beside the historic Great Bricett Church, this beautifully renovated three-bedroom semi-detached home offers a rare blend of period character and modern sophistication. Every element has been thoughtfully considered to create a property that feels both timeless and contemporary, with the surrounding countryside providing a truly idyllic backdrop.

Upon entering, the first reception room presents a charming snug or home office, complete with a log burner set within an exposed brick fireplace — a cosy retreat for quieter moments. The second reception room is a generous, dual-aspect living space, featuring solid wooden flooring and an exposed brick chimney that adds warmth and texture to the room’s natural light.

The kitchen and dining area form the heart of this remarkable home. Recently extended, it combines the craftsmanship of a Shaker-style kitchen with the drama of a vaulted ceiling and feature wooden beam. Bi-fold doors open fully to reveal the garden and sweeping views of the Suffolk countryside beyond, while Velux windows bathe the room in daylight. Wooden worktops, a Rangemaster cooker, and space for an American-style fridge/freezer complete the space, while slate-style flooring continues seamlessly onto the rear patio, creating a beautiful flow between inside and out.

Upstairs, two double bedrooms enjoy charming views towards the church, while the principal bedroom benefits from built-in wardrobes and captures far-reaching vistas across open countryside. The bathroom is finished to an exceptional standard, featuring a striking slate accent wall, a freestanding bath, a large walk-in shower, and a contemporary basin. The landing is subtly enhanced by integrated LED strip lighting, adding a touch of understated luxury.

Outside, the landscaped garden opens directly onto the surrounding fields, offering uninterrupted views and a deep sense of privacy. A collection of outbuildings, including a dedicated office, provide versatility for modern living.

Perfectly positioned in one of Suffolk’s most picturesque village settings, this home combines rural tranquility with exquisite design — a truly exceptional residence where character and contemporary living meet in perfect harmony.

Local Area Guide – Great Bricett, Suffolk
Transport & Connections:
• Convenient access to both Needham Market and Stowmarket train stations, offering direct rail links to Ipswich, Bury St Edmunds and London.
• Local bus routes connect the village with surrounding towns and communities.
• The A14 provides excellent road connections to Ipswich, Cambridge and the Midlands.
• Suffolk’s Demand Responsive Transport and Taxi Bus services offer flexible travel options for rural residents.

Schools & Education:
• Ringshall Primary School serves the local area and enjoys a strong reputation.
• Stowmarket High School provides secondary education within the local catchment.
• Additional primary schools can be found in Elmsett, Somersham, Bildeston and Bosmere.

Local Amenities:
• The village benefits from a charming hall, originally a Victorian school building, which hosts regular community events.
• St Mary and St Lawrence Church stands as a historic centrepiece within the village.
• Suffolk Libraries’ mobile service visits regularly, providing convenient access to library facilities.
• The surrounding countryside offers a wealth of scenic walking routes and bridleways, ideal for outdoor pursuits.

Pubs, Restaurants & Leisure:
• The Red Lion in Great Bricett is a traditional, Grade II listed country pub offering a warm welcome, hearty food and a spacious garden.
• The Bildeston Crown, an award-winning coaching inn, offers fine dining in an elegant yet relaxed setting, showcasing locally sourced produce and an acclaimed wine list.
• Nearby Needham Market offers a variety of cafés, restaurants and independent eateries.
• Stowmarket and Ipswich provide a wider selection of dining, leisure and entertainment options.

Nearby Towns & Shopping:
• Needham Market provides everyday amenities including a supermarket, post office, butchers, bakery and local shops.
• Stowmarket offers a broader range of retail outlets, supermarkets, leisure facilities and healthcare services.
• Ipswich delivers extensive shopping, cultural attractions and employment opportunities.

Lifestyle & Setting:
• Great Bricett offers an exceptional balance of rural tranquility and community spirit.
• The village is defined by its historic architecture, open countryside and peaceful atmosphere.
• A friendly, active community hosts regular events centred around the village hall, church and local pub.
